      I am thinking about changing the name of my site. The new name is available with .re domain (that spells the name) or a .com. I have registered the .re and the .com is parked and for sale so my question has 2 parts.

      Is it worth buying the .com or do I really not need it? How much does it matter in terms of losing traffic and other factors?

      If I do buy it which should I use as the primary domain?

        Officially it is said that the CC of a TLD makes no difference for the ranking if you do your SEO homework right...

        I would agree with that in general BUT inofficially the CC of your domain matters in your case - .re is not comparable to  a .com domain! Take a look at the serach results: there are only a very few examples that a .re is ranking on high position outside it`s dedicated country.

        If a CCtld spells the name of your project it has no real influence or relevanve for the googlebot... it`s just a nice thing for yourself, marketing and maybe the visitors of your site.

        You dont need to buy the .com domain but if you can do so, I would always prefer this solution. This is always a question of money and if its worth it for you.

        My opinion is based on long-term experiences.

        If you rename your project it`s easy to transfer linkjuice, authority etc. by using a 301 redirection...
